Description Possible Reason for Trip
ATN5 NEGATIVE SLIP F
♦ Autotune has calculated a negative slip frequency,
which is not valid. Nameplate rpm may have been set
to a value higher than the base speed of the motor.
Check nameplate rpm, base frequency, and pole pairs
are correct.
ATN6 TR TOO LARGE
♦ The calculated value of rotor time constant is too
large. Check the value of nameplate rpm.
ATN7 TR TOO SMALL
♦ The calculated value of rotor time constant is too
small. Check the value of nameplate rpm.
ATN8 MAX RPM DATA ERR
♦ This error is reported when the MAX SPEED RPM is
set to a value outside the range for which Autotune
has gathered data. Autotune gathers data on the motor
characteristics
up to 30% beyond “max speed rpm”. If
MAX SPEED RPM is later increased beyond this
range, the drive had no data for this new operating
area, and so will report an error. To run the motor
beyond this point it is necessary to re-autotune with
MAX SPEED RPM set to a higher value.
